Default RE: peak weight vs. lowering poundage

i asked the same question back in the 80's and was told it doesn't matter where the weight is set. the bows is disigned to shoot at all weight ranges and the lower poundage actually puts less stress on the equipment. shoot what feels best to you. lower poundage equals less muscle fatigue so it may shoot better than something you have to apply a lot of effort to draw. less rotator cuff issues also.
